2026 Cross Country World Championships Heading to Tallahassee; Tokyo to Host 2025 World Athletics Championships

The World Athletics Council has selected Tallahassee, Florida, to host the 2026 World Athletics Cross Country Championships, while also selecting Tokyo’s Olympic Stadium to host the 2025 World Athletics Championships and awarding the 2025 world cross country championships to Croatia. The announcement was made during the 228th World Athletics Council Meeting in Oregon ahead of […]
